
When it comes to maximizing the versatility of the KTM 500 EXC, selecting the best on-road and off-road tires is crucial for balancing performance across diverse terrains. These tires must offer exceptional grip and durability for aggressive off-road trails while maintaining stability and longevity on paved surfaces. Top contenders like the Michelin Starcross 5 and Pirelli Scorpion Rally STR excel in off-road traction and durability, while options such as the Continental TKC 70 and Mitas E-09 provide a smoother on-road experience without sacrificing off-road capability. The ideal tire choice ultimately depends on the rider’s preference for off-road dominance versus on-road comfort, ensuring the KTM 500 EXC remains a formidable dual-sport machine.

Frequently asked questions
The best on-road and off-road tires for a KTM 500 EXC depend on your riding style and terrain preferences. Popular dual-sport options include the Pirelli Scorpion Rally STR and Continental TKC 70, which offer a balanced mix of on-road stability and off-road traction. For more aggressive off-road use, the Michelin Enduro Medium or Maxxis Desert IT are excellent choices, though they may wear faster on pavement.
Balancing durability and performance involves choosing tires with a harder compound for longevity on roads, like the Mitas E-09, while softer compounds like the Kenda K784 Big Bore provide better off-road grip but wear faster. Consider your riding ratio (on-road vs. off-road) to prioritize one over the other.
Yes, tires like the Bridgestone Battlecross X30 and Maxxis Razr II excel in muddy and rocky conditions due to their aggressive tread patterns and robust construction. However, they may feel less stable on paved roads compared to dual-sport tires.
For on-road riding, maintain higher tire pressure (around 30-32 PSI) to reduce rolling resistance and improve stability. For off-road, lower the pressure to 12-18 PSI to increase traction and absorb impacts, depending on terrain difficulty.
Tire replacement frequency depends on usage and tire type. Dual-sport tires typically last 3,000-5,000 miles, while aggressive off-road tires may wear out in 1,000-2,000 miles. Inspect tires regularly for wear, tears, or punctures, and replace them when tread depth is insufficient or performance degrades.
